132 CARAVAN DAYShad travelled 120 miles, and we had had morethan enough of it.The kettle came to the boil and tea wasserved :simultaneously Herbert appeared witha favourable report. That was no small relief,but we had no idea of how good a thing we hadstruck in the hour of our extremity. The hillwas very steep, and the van had to turn backand drive up another way. We skirted round thehouse and buildings and past the yard and poultryrunand there we came upon our very heart'sdesire. It was a great stackyard, set about onthree sides with vast round haystacks toweringinto the blue.In the centre was a little ver-updant square, level as a billiard table and theshort, fresh turf upon it was like a fair greencarpet laid down. We drew up in the centre andshut in as we were we need no longer believein the existence of the road, not fifty yards belowus, or of the belching chimneys beyond.
